Provided by SuperpagesI absolutely love this restaurant. When I heard the chef was from Beverly Hills Grill, I knew it would be good. The food is creative, delicious, well prepared and presented, the specials are always interesting, and some of the staples on the menu are personal favorites - pulled chicken salad, roasted exotic mushroom appetizer with boursin, the grilled asparagus and the meatloaf. Not forgetting the Ray's ice cream! Service is always friendly and professional, they have a nice front patio, though some of the tables are a little cramped, but the front floor to ceiling doors open completely in nice weather to bring the outside in to the front of the restaurant. I ate there with a friend last night, and my husband and I are ordering carry outs tonight! Yes, it's a little spendy, but worth it. We don't splurge on vacations, sporting events or concerts and don't have kids, so we like to indulge in really good food a couple times a month, and this is my current fave.
